Serbia - Number of Passenger Railcars

Since 2014, Serbia Number of Passenger Railcars was down by 5.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 11 among other countries in Number of Passenger Railcars with 254 Units. Serbia is overtaken by Canada, which was number 10 at 550 Units and is followed by Slovenia with 249 Units. France lead the ranking with 11,115 Units in 2019, a growth of 2.3% versus 2018. Poland, Spain and Romania resp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Turkey recorded the best 5 years average growth at +25.8% per year, while Belarus recorded the worst performance at -9.2% per year.
